#356b8e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#356b8e is composed of 20.8% red, 42%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 203.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 38.2%. #356b8e color hex could be obtained by blending #6ad6ff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#356b8e color description : Dark moderate blue.
#356b8e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#356b8e has RGB values of R:53, G:107,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3500942.

Shades and Tints of #356b8e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a0d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#356b8e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b6369 is the less saturated color, while #0076c3 is the most saturated one.
